Gene Ontology curation at WormBase is performed through several different pipelines:
1. Manual curation of the literature
2. Semi-automated, Textpresso-based curation of Cellular Component and Molecular Function
3. Phenotype2GO mappings for Biological Process curation (both VariationPhenotype2GO and RNAiPhenotype2GO)
4. InterPro2GO mappings for sequence-based IEA annotations
5. Reference Genome inferential annotations
